It's official. They all do that when fitted with 17" wheels. I am a cop in the UK and we got the first batch of V70N traffic cars in 2000. We all commented about the rubbishy turning circle and the fact that the tyres rubbed on the inner wings. Volvo's response was: "They all have the same turning circle and the rubbing tyres is not detrimental to the lifespan of the tyres." So there.
